HSBC Corporate and Institutional Banking (CIB) is a markets-led, financing-focused business that provides investment and financial solutions. Within CIB, Securities Services provides robust and reliable solutions that help clients mitigate risk and enhance their business performance. Working with institutional investors, banks, insurance companies, governments, and multinational corporations, this team covers fund administration, global custody, sub-custody and clearing, and corporate trust and loan agency services.
